In the wild, bird remains are often found in the stool of young ball pythons. (Or in the stomachs of dead ones)


From what I understand, it won't hurt to feed a chick...but expect to have some pretty nasty, runny stools afterward. I'm not sure an all-bird diet would be healthy for the life of the snake, though. Studies of wild behavior show a significant change-over to a mostly rodent diet as they mature.
